“I really liked the Air guitar”

Little Gabin, a CP student in Aigrefeuille-sur-Maine (near Nantes), was already on his little cloud while the long-awaited Aldebert concert had not yet started at the Hellfest Kids this Wednesday, June 26.

The first edition of this mini-Hellfest for children has been all the rage and it’s not because of the high temperatures.

Real metal concert stage

Hundreds of children from Clisson and the surrounding area jumped, sang and danced under the benevolent and amused gaze of their parents and/or carers.

Designed to accommodate a capacity of 3,000 people, the Bellevue site, in Gétigné, not far from the Hellfest site, was transformed into real metal concert stage, worthy of Mainstage or other Warzone.

The makeup-tattoo stand is quickly taken over by children

With all around, a bar, a “merch” stand with t-shirts, books and albums by Aldebert, and a makeup-tattoo stand that is quickly taken over by the children.

This festival, imagined by Ben Barbaud’s team (present for this great first), was dedicated to the 850 CP students from the Clisson urban community. Like little Naomi from Gorges, who came with her big sister Eva and her dad.

“It’s very well organized”

The family couldn’t miss this event: “It’s very well organized, we didn’t have to struggle by car to get to Gétigné,” confides the father. We have the Aldebert CD playing on repeat at home. The girls were delighted when we got the tickets.”

The long-awaited Aldebert concert

While the Air guitar competition between children and specialists of the genre such as Medusa, champion of the category at Hellfest in 2023, electrified the public, Antoine and Manon, parents of Gabin, appreciate the moment:

This Hellfest Kids is truly representative of Hellfest. We didn’t expect to see such a big stage, the resources put in place, it’s impressive… And it’s free. We can hardly complain!

Antoine and Manon, parents of Gabin

A few days before the summer holidays, this Hellfest Kids started strong with the group Smash Hit Combo.

It ended in apotheosis with the concert of the star of recess: Aldebert, who came to play pieces from his latest album “Helldebert – Enfantillages 666”.
